New Folsom Bridge Progressing

Quote
Folsom business owners are eagerly awaiting the completion of a new bridge in hopes it will bring customers back to downtown.

Folsom Dam Road, which passes over Folsom Dam, has been closed since 2003 because of security concerns.

The old road was used by about 20,000 drivers each day. Those drivers must now use other routes.

To make up for the closure, a new bridge is being built over the American River just downstream from the dam. The new span will connect Folsom Auburn Road north of the river to downtown, which sits south of the river.

The project is expected to be done in about a year.

"It will be here before we know it," said Rick Lorenz, Folsom public works director.

So far, two huge columns are taking shape. These will eventually support a roadway about 250 feet above the river.

The project will help businesses in the old part of Folsom, said Paula Watson, owner of Planet Earth Rising. Several shops failed after the road over the dam was closed.

"I think it will have a positive effect," said Watson, whose shop sells crystals, jewelry and clothing.
